Descriptions starting top left (clockwise):
- A bride poses among a flock of pigeons during a pre-wedding photoshoot in Beijing. Over 1,000 couples waited in line to get their marriage licenses to wed on August 8/08 (08/08/08 is considered lucky because the number 8 stands for ‘fa’ or ‘to get wealthy’). The date also marks the opening ceremony of the Olympics held in Beijing.
- Reality TV stars (The Bachelorette) Ryan and Trista Sutter joined 20 other couples in a group wedding photo in a special “Mamma Mia!”themed wedding in a Burbank, CA IKEA on July 17, 2008.
- 39 police officers married in a collective Catholic wedding in Bagota.
- Little Jasper and Levi sit awkwardy after their ‘I will’ declaration during Children’s Wedding Day at the Science Museum NEMO in Amsterdam. The marriage lasts only one day, ending just after sunset.
